excel表格内所有数字怎么求和

excel表格内所有数字怎么求和

Excel表格内所有数字求和的方法包括:使用SUM函数、使用快捷键、使用自动求和功能、使用宏命令等。其中,使用SUM函数是最常用且简便的一种方法。

使用SUM函数可以快速地将单元格区域内的所有数字求和。具体操作步骤如下:首先,选中要求和的单元格区域,然后在目标单元格中输入公式=SUM(选中的单元格区域),按下回车键即可。例如,若要求和A1到A10的数字,只需在目标单元格中输入=SUM(A1:A10),按下回车键,结果就会自动显示在目标单元格中。

接下来,我们将详细介绍几种在Excel中求和的方法,并探讨它们的优缺点和适用情境。

一、使用SUM函数求和

1. 基本用法

SUM函数是Excel中最基本的求和函数,用于计算一组数字的总和。SUM函数的基本语法是:=SUM(数字1, 数字2, ..., 数字n),其中“数字”可以是单个数字、单元格引用或单元格区域。

例如,若要求和A1到A10的数字,只需在目标单元格中输入=SUM(A1:A10),按下回车键,结果就会自动显示在目标单元格中。

2. 多区域求和

除了对单个区域求和外,SUM函数还可以对多个不连续的区域进行求和。假设需要对A1到A10和B1到B10的数字求和,可以使用以下公式:=SUM(A1:A10, B1:B10)。这样,SUM函数会将两个区域内的所有数字相加,并返回总和。

3. 条件求和

在某些情况下,可能需要根据特定条件对数字进行求和。可以使用SUMIF或SUMIFS函数来实现条件求和。SUMIF函数的基本语法是:=SUMIF(条件区域, 条件, 求和区域),其中“条件区域”是要检查条件的单元格区域,“条件”是要满足的条件,“求和区域”是要求和的单元格区域。

例如,若要对A列中大于10的数字求和,可以使用以下公式:=SUMIF(A:A, ">10")

二、使用快捷键求和

1. 自动求和快捷键

Excel提供了一个快捷键来快速求和选定的单元格区域。选中要求和的单元格区域,然后按下快捷键Alt+=(等号),Excel会自动在选定区域下方或右侧的单元格中插入一个SUM函数,并计算总和。

2. 快速填充

若需要对多行或多列进行求和,可以使用Excel的快速填充功能。选中第一行或第一列的求和结果,然后将鼠标指针移到选中区域的右下角,当指针变成一个小黑十字时,向下或向右拖动,Excel会自动填充后续的求和公式,并计算每行或每列的总和。

三、使用自动求和功能

Excel的“自动求和”功能可以快速计算选定区域的总和。以下是使用自动求和功能的步骤:

1. 选中区域

首先,选中要求和的单元格区域。可以通过鼠标拖动或Shift键配合方向键来选中区域。

2. 自动求和按钮

在Excel的“开始”选项卡中,找到“编辑”组中的“自动求和”按钮(通常是一个Σ符号)。点击该按钮,Excel会自动在选定区域下方或右侧的单元格中插入一个SUM函数,并计算总和。

3. 确认结果

确认自动求和结果是否正确。如果需要调整求和区域,可以手动修改SUM函数中的单元格引用。

四、使用宏命令求和

对于需要反复进行求和操作的情况,可以编写一个宏命令来自动完成求和。以下是一个简单的VBA宏命令示例,用于计算当前工作表中所有单元格的总和:

Sub SumAllNumbers()

Dim ws As Worksheet

Dim cell As Range

Dim total As Double

total = 0

Set ws = ThisWorkbook.Sheets("Sheet1") ' 修改为实际的工作表名称

For Each cell In ws.UsedRange

If IsNumeric(cell.Value) Then

total = total + cell.Value

End If

Next cell

MsgBox "所有数字的总和是: " & total

End Sub

1. 打开VBA编辑器

按下Alt+F11打开VBA编辑器。

2. 插入模块

在VBA编辑器中,点击“插入”菜单,选择“模块”选项,插入一个新的模块。

3. 粘贴代码

将上述代码粘贴到新模块中。

4. 运行宏命令

关闭VBA编辑器,返回Excel工作表。按下Alt+F8打开宏命令对话框,选择“SumAllNumbers”宏,点击“运行”按钮,宏命令将自动计算当前工作表中所有数字的总和,并弹出一个消息框显示结果。

五、使用Power Query求和

Power Query是一种功能强大的数据处理工具,可以用于导入、整理和分析数据。以下是使用Power Query求和的步骤:

1. 导入数据

在Excel中,点击“数据”选项卡,选择“获取数据”按钮,从当前工作簿导入数据。

2. 转换数据

在Power Query编辑器中,对数据进行必要的转换和清理操作。例如,可以将数据类型转换为数字类型,删除不需要的列等。

3. 添加求和列

在Power Query编辑器中,点击“添加列”选项卡,选择“自定义列”按钮。在弹出的对话框中,输入自定义列名称和求和公式。例如,可以使用以下公式对所有列求和:=List.Sum({[列1], [列2], ..., [列n]})

4. 加载数据

完成数据转换后,点击“关闭并加载”按钮,将处理后的数据加载回Excel工作表。

六、使用数据透视表求和

数据透视表是一种强大的数据分析工具,可以快速汇总和分析大量数据。以下是使用数据透视表求和的步骤:

1. 创建数据透视表

在Excel中,选中要分析的数据区域,点击“插入”选项卡,选择“数据透视表”按钮。选择数据源和目标位置,点击“确定”按钮,创建一个新的数据透视表。

2. 配置数据透视表

在数据透视表字段列表中,将要求和的字段拖动到“值”区域。Excel会自动对该字段进行求和,并在数据透视表中显示结果。

3. 自定义数据透视表

可以根据需要自定义数据透视表的布局和样式。例如,可以添加筛选器、分类汇总、计算字段等,以便更好地分析数据。

七、使用数组公式求和

数组公式是一种高级Excel功能,可以对一组数据进行复杂的计算。以下是使用数组公式求和的步骤:

1. 选择目标单元格

首先,选择一个单元格或单元格区域来存储求和结果。

2. 输入数组公式

在目标单元格中输入数组公式。例如,若要对A1到A10和B1到B10的数字求和,可以使用以下数组公式:=SUM(A1:A10 + B1:B10)

3. 确认数组公式

按下Ctrl+Shift+Enter确认数组公式,Excel会自动在公式两端添加花括号,并计算结果。

八、使用条件格式求和

条件格式是一种用于突出显示特定单元格的格式设置工具。以下是使用条件格式求和的步骤:

1. 选中数据区域

首先,选中要应用条件格式的数据区域。

2. 添加条件格式

在Excel的“开始”选项卡中,找到“样式”组中的“条件格式”按钮。点击该按钮,选择“新建规则”选项。

3. 配置条件格式

在弹出的对话框中,选择“使用公式确定要设置格式的单元格”选项。输入条件公式,例如,若要对大于10的数字进行求和,可以使用以下公式:=A1>10

4. 应用格式

配置要应用的格式,例如,可以设置单元格背景颜色、字体颜色等。点击“确定”按钮应用条件格式。

5. 使用SUBTOTAL函数

使用SUBTOTAL函数可以对已应用条件格式的单元格进行求和。SUBTOTAL函数的基本语法是:=SUBTOTAL(函数编号, 引用1, 引用2, ..., 引用n),其中“函数编号”用于指定要执行的函数类型,例如,求和的函数编号是9。

例如,若要对已应用条件格式的A1到A10单元格进行求和,可以使用以下公式:=SUBTOTAL(9, A1:A10)

九、使用自定义函数求和

可以编写自定义函数来实现特定的求和操作。以下是一个简单的VBA自定义函数示例,用于计算当前工作表中所有单元格的总和:

Function SumAllCells(range As Range) As Double

Dim cell As Range

Dim total As Double

total = 0

For Each cell In range

If IsNumeric(cell.Value) Then

total = total + cell.Value

End If

Next cell

SumAllCells = total

End Function

1. 打开VBA编辑器

按下Alt+F11打开VBA编辑器。

2. 插入模块

在VBA编辑器中,点击“插入”菜单,选择“模块”选项,插入一个新的模块。

3. 粘贴代码

将上述代码粘贴到新模块中。

4. 使用自定义函数

关闭VBA编辑器,返回Excel工作表。在目标单元格中输入自定义函数,例如,若要对A1到A10的数字求和,可以使用以下公式:=SumAllCells(A1:A10)

以上是Excel表格内所有数字求和的多种方法。根据具体情况选择适合的方法,可以提高工作效率,确保数据处理的准确性。无论是使用SUM函数、快捷键、自动求和功能,还是通过编写宏命令、自定义函数等,都能实现高效的数据求和操作。

相关问答FAQs:

1. 如何在Excel中求和一个特定范围内的数字?

在Excel中,可以使用SUM函数来求和特定范围内的数字。只需选中需要求和的单元格范围,然后在求和的单元格中输入"=SUM(选中的单元格范围)"即可。例如,如果要求和A1到A10单元格范围内的数字,可以在求和单元格中输入"=SUM(A1:A10)"。

2. 如何在Excel中求和不连续的单元格范围内的数字?

如果要求和不连续的单元格范围内的数字,可以使用SUM函数的多个参数。只需在求和的单元格中输入"=SUM(第一个范围, 第二个范围, …)",每个范围之间用逗号分隔。例如,如果要求和A1到A5和C1到C5的数字,可以在求和单元格中输入"=SUM(A1:A5, C1:C5)"。

3. 如何在Excel中求和满足特定条件的数字?

如果要求和满足特定条件的数字,可以使用SUMIF函数。只需在求和的单元格中输入"=SUMIF(条件范围, 条件, 求和范围)"。例如,如果要求和A1到A10范围内大于5的数字,可以在求和单元格中输入"=SUMIF(A1:A10, ">5")"。如果要求和满足多个条件的数字,可以使用SUMIFS函数。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4695671

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部